Macedonian

Etymology

Inherited from Proto-Slavic *dьràti (to tear, to flay)

Pronunciation

Verb

дере (dere) third-singular presentimpf (perfective одере)

  1. (transitive) to skin, flay

Tabasaran

Etymology

From a Turkic language, ultimately from Persian دره. Compare Azerbaijani dərə.

Noun

дере (dere)

  1. valley
